credits

released May 30, 2012

Engineered by Mike Ashmore and Tony Miola at Domesound Studios in Royersford, PA

Edited, mixed, and mastered by Matt Buckley

artwork by Mike Schank with Trauma Rising Design (www.facebook.com/traumarisingd)

Drop Anchor Souderton, Pennsylvania

Drop Anchor is a 4-piece rock band from the greater Philadelphia, PA area. Drawing from influences such as Alice in Chains, Failure, Torche, and Deftones, this group brings a down-tuned, groovy style and stretches it across modern metal trends to meet with 90s garage rock.
